Experience a full day of insights and innovation as we bring together Leading Minds of Governance & Tech—featuring expert panel discussions, an extensive Q&A, and a fireside chat on CEO-board relationships with Rich Lesser, CEO of Boston Consulting Group—and 2025 NACD New England Visionaries Speak, where four leading CEOs share their bold perspectives on the future of business and governance.
In an era marked by rapid transformation, geopolitical tensions, and stakeholder scrutiny, today’s board leaders must look beyond the headlines to see what’s ahead. Visionaries brings together three of New England’s most forward-looking CEOs for a powerful discussion on the forces shaping the future of business and governance.
These industry leaders—representing sectors from advanced materials to global manufacturing—will share their insights on innovation, sustainability, risk, and opportunity in an increasingly complex world. From navigating global markets and AI disruption to redefining leadership in a purpose-driven economy, this is a rare opportunity to hear from those driving real change.
Moderated by Cathy Minehan, former President & CEO of the Federal Reserve Bank of Boston and current President of NACD New England, this conversation promises both strategic depth and practical foresight.
Audience questions are encouraged, and ample time will be reserved for open dialogue. Don’t miss your chance to hear from these influential leaders as they explore what’s next—and how directors and executives can be ready for it.
